The Medical Context of Obesity in Italy
Italy, regardless of its world-renowned Mediterranean diet rich in fresh veggies, lean proteins, and healthy fats, is not immune to the rising worldwide rates of overweight and obesity. According to health data, a considerable portion of the Italian adult population is classified as either obese or overweight, positioning a heavy burden on the nationwide healthcare system (Servizio Sanitario Nazionale-- SSN).
For years, weight management was framed almost specifically as a matter of willpower, diet, and workout. Nevertheless, contemporary endocrinology and internal medication view weight problems as a complex, persistent, and multifactorial illness influenced by genes, hormones, metabolic process, and environmental factors. This paradigm shift has unlocked for pharmaceutical interventions developed to help control hunger, blood sugar level, and satiety.

One of the most defining features of the Italian pharmaceutical market is the rigorous oversight by AIFA. Unlike in some nations where weight-loss medications can be easily gotten through personal telehealth platforms, Italy maintains strenuous controls to ensure client safety and equitable distribution.
- Prescription Requirements: None of the potent, contemporary weight-loss injections can be acquired non-prescription. They need a specialized medical prescription, generally provided by an endocrinologist, bariatrician, or internal medication expert.
- Reimbursement Criteria: Historically, weight-loss drugs were rarely reimbursed by the SSN, significance patients paid completely out of pocket. Nevertheless, AIFA occasionally updates its policies based on scientific trial data demonstrating cardiovascular benefits and long-lasting health expense savings. Reimbursement is usually restricted to patients fulfilling specific clinical thresholds, such as:
- A Body Mass Index (BMI) of ₤ ge ₤ 30 kg/m ² (weight problems), or
- A BMI of ₤ ge ₤ 27 kg/m ² with at least one weight-related comorbid condition (e.g., type 2 diabetes, high blood pressure, obstructive sleep apnea, or dyslipidemia).
Benefits and Challenges of Modern Pharmacotherapy
The introduction of GLP-1 and dual-agonist therapies has actually transformed weight management, but they include distinct benefits and obstacles.
Potential Benefits
- Significant Weight Reduction: Clinical trials have shown that more recent generations of medications can help patients lose a considerable percentage of their overall body weight, far surpassing traditional diet and exercise alone.
- Metabolic Improvements: Beyond weight reduction, numerous of these drugs improve glycemic control, lower high blood pressure, and reduce systemic swelling.
- Cardiovascular Protection: Recent landmark research studies show that particular weight reduction drugs significantly decrease the danger of major negative cardiovascular occasions, such as stroke and cardiac arrest.
Obstacles and Considerations
- Supply Chain Shortages: Global demand has regularly outmatched manufacturing capacity, causing intermittent shortages of medications like Wegovy and Ozempic in Italian pharmacies.
- Adverse effects: Common adverse effects are primarily gastrointestinal, including queasiness, throwing up, diarrhea, or irregularity, particularly when starting treatment or increasing the dosage.
- Expense and Accessibility: For people who do not receive SSN reimbursement, buying these medications independently can represent a significant month-to-month monetary dedication.
- Long-Term Commitment: Obesity is a persistent condition; clinical information suggests that stopping the medication typically results in weight restore, suggesting treatment is frequently recommended as a long-term intervention.

2. Does the Italian National Health Service (SSN) pay for weight loss drugs?
Repayment depends upon the specific drug, AIFA guidelines, and the patient's clinical profile. While some medications are partly or totally reimbursed for particular patient groups (such as those with serious obesity-related comorbidities), many individuals need to pay out-of-pocket for treatments prescribed strictly for cosmetic weight-loss or milder types of obese.
3. What are the most common side results of these medications?
The most frequently reported adverse effects affect the gastrointestinal system. They include queasiness, moderate throwing up, diarrhea, irregularity, and stomach bloating. These symptoms generally take place when beginning the medication or escalating the dose and typically decrease gradually.
4. Can I get a prescription for weight reduction drugs by means of telehealth in Italy?
Telehealth regulations in Italy are becoming more structured, but initial assessments for potent persistent weight management medications normally require a detailed in-person medical assessment, consisting of blood work and a physical assessment by a specialist.
5. What happens if I stop taking the medication?
Since obesity is dealt with as a chronic medical condition, stopping weight-loss medications often leads to a gradual return of hunger and subsequent weight regain. Any choice to discontinue treatment must be made in close consultation with your recommending physician.
